How Our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Process Works

When you call us, our team springs into action, equipped with the latest technology and a strict adherence to IICRC standards. We start by assessing the damage, taking precise moisture readings to identify the extent of the issue. This allows us to develop a customized drying plan tailored to your home’s specific needs.

Step 1: Containment and Inspection

Our technicians isolate the affected area, using specialized equipment to prevent further water intrusion. We then con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source of the leak and assess the dam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use commercial-grade w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ing drying time.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our equipment is designed to remove excess moisture from the air, ensuring your home dries quickly and safely. We monitor the drying process closely, using moisture meters to ensure the area is safe to inhabit.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Deodorizing

We use specialized solutions to kill b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ms that may have been present in the water. This step is essential in preventing the growth of mold and mildew.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We then clean and disinfect the area, leaving it safe and ready for use.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Snohomish, WA

The cost of wet vacuum water ext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Snohomish, WA. Our prices are competitive and based on the best practices and technology available.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Inspection $200 – $500 Size of the affected area and complexity of the job.
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Volume of water extracted and equipment used.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area and equipment used.
Sanitizing and Deodorizing $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and complexity of the job.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Size of the affected area and complexity of the job.
More Services (e.g., mold remediation, carpet drying) $500 – $2,500 Complexity of the job and equipment used.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an to fit your budget and needs.

How long does the drying process take?

The drying process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. Our team will work with you to create a customized drying plan to ensure your home is safe and dry as quickly as possible.
